  1. Grey Towers National Historic Site: This historic site, once the home of Gifford Pinchot, features stunning architecture and lush gardens. Visitors can explore the rich cultural history and enjoy guided tours that showcase its beautiful interiors and scenic grounds.
  2. Raymondskill Falls: The tallest waterfall in Pennsylvania, Raymondskill Falls offers a picturesque setting perfect for romantic walks and outdoor adventures. Hiking trails lead visitors to breathtaking views and the soothing sounds of cascading water.
  3. High Point State Park: Just 7 miles from Milford, this national park boasts breathtaking scenery, hiking trails, and picnic areas. Enjoy outdoor adventures like hiking, birdwatching, and taking in stunning vistas from the highest point in New Jersey.

The famous 'bloody Lincoln flag'

Ambling along the handsome tree-lined streets in Milford, a town packed with pretty Victorian architecture, is a must-do activity in itself. Near Milford vacation rentals is the Columns Museum, home to the Pike County Historical Society. Open on several days a week throughout the year, the museum's most famous attraction is the 'bloody Lincoln flag' on which the assassinated President's head once lay, as well as a collection of belongings from the mathematician and philosopher Charles Sanders Pierce. It's a fascinating place that's well worth a visit.

67,000 acres of park to discover

The Delaware Water Gap National Recreation Area lies right on the doorstep of Milford vacation rentals. Here, you'll have easy access to more than 67,000 acres of river valley and forested mountain to explore. You can lace up your hiking boots and go walking along the countless miles of trails which pass tumbling waterfalls and cross through hemlock forests, habitats used by a plethora of wildlife. This includes a swathe of the vast Appalachian Trail, a bucket list hike for any rambler. Alternatively, jump on your bike to ride along the vast stretches of scenic roadways.

Watch great blue herons

From your Milford vacation rental you can easily reach the Delaware Water Gap National Recreation Area, whose habitats range from river bends to ridgetops and supports a diverse list of wildlife species. Solitary black bears amble along the forest floors while tiny ruby-throated hummingbirds swoop around the trees. You can watch great blue herons wading into the waters in search of fish, of which there are over 60 species which swim along the rivers. As nightfall descends, the nocturnal species awaken and include raccoons, foxes and several species of bat.
